ICE Funding Accountability Act

United States119th CongressS-3933Senate
Updated: Feb 26, 2026

Summary

This bill establishes a spending limitation on funds appropriated or made available under Public Law 119-21, referred to as the "One Big Beautiful Bill Act." Its primary purpose is to restrict the use of these specific funds for certain immigration enforcement personnel activities. Specifically, the legislation prohibits the expenditure of these funds to pay the salaries of any U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) or U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) agents or officers who are hired on or after the date of the bill's enactment. Furthermore, it explicitly forbids the use of these funds for activities related to the recruitment , advertising for hiring, or payment of retention or sign-on bonuses for such new agents or officers. This measure aims to prevent the expansion of ICE and CBP personnel using funds from the designated act.
